#2E8419 sits at 108° on the color wheel, placing it in the green family of the cool half of the spectrum. With 68% saturation and 31% lightness, it reads as a richly saturated, shadowed tone — a balanced mid-energy presence that sits comfortably alongside other UI tones. Its RGB mix of 46, 132, 25 produces a 4.74:1 contrast ratio against white, which clears WCAG AA for body text in that pairing.
In RGB space #2E8419 is a close cousin of CSS forest green — about 17 units away from #228B22. Designers reach for green hues at this saturation when the brief calls for a conversational, mid-energy register, and at this lightness when they want a present, comfortable mid-canvas voice. On screen the cool cast tends to pair best with warm neutrals in the 25°-45° range to add life.
